What You'll Do as a Senior Account Executive:
Our Senior Account Executives (SAE) own 100% of the sales cycle for opportunities within their assigned territory and contribute to the overall revenue growth and development of the company.
Key responsibilities include:
- Building and developing a sales funnel by researching, identifying, approaching, and developing relationships with new prospective enterprise client accounts in agreedupon subcategories of the corporate verticals.
- Achieve or exceed net new business quota targets as outlined in your employment agreement.
- Responsible for strategic pipeline growth through virtual and inperson (travel) networking opportunities within industry working groups, conferences, and associations.
- Manage the potential prospects through the purchasing process, including demos, trials, procurement, etc. Define trial success criteria and work with the Customer Experience (Cx) teams to ensure success and close business.
- Ensure prospects have all resources/materials needed for purchasing decisions.
- Introduce newly signed clients to the Account Manager with the information necessary to form a successful relationship and account transition.
- Maintain internal CRM (currently Salesforce).
What You Need to Get the Job Done:
- 5 years+ in sales with proven skills in closing business
- Demonstrated ability of effective prospect (conduct a multichannel outreach campaign and connect with decisionmakers), account and customer management (understanding their needs, addressing their challenges, connecting the dots, effectively qualifying and disqualify leads), and the grid to manage a 4monthlong sales process
- Knowledge and understanding of best practice sales tactics and different stages of the sales cycle
- Ability to sell virtually (over the phone and via Zoom/Google Meet)
- Excellent interpersonal, networking, and presentation skill and a strong focus on growing revenue
- The ability to work independently and to create your own lead generation/sales funnel
- Willingness to change your existing process and follow the LifeRaft sales process where needed or required.
